Cable Jacks & Tower fOR Drum Lifting

SEB JT40 is a 40 tonne drum lifting cable jack suitable for holding, supporting and retaining a cable drum securely in place to enable safe pulling and laying of cables. The drum jack allows simpler uncoiling of the cable improving productivity and reducing time required for LV-HV cable installations.

Lifting jacks and towers are available to provide cable drum stability for pulling and laying operations with ranges of 20, 30 and 40 tonne capacity – contact us with your requirements.

DRUM LIFTING CABLE JACKS 40 TONNE – SEB JT40

  • 40 Tonne Capacity SWL Per Pair of Cable Jacks
  • Minimum Drum Dia 3000mm
  • Maximum Drum Dia 4500mm
  • Base Area 2000x1000mm
  • Weight Per Pair 1150kgs
